The two walked one after the other through the laughing and joking crowd toward the open-air bar not far away. Before they got close, Cheng Chenyu and his colleague hissed and slowed down.
"My goodness, it's like a celebrity meet-and-greet here, Sister Ying."
Before Song Yueying could even look for Chu Chen after arriving at the scene, people nearby had already gathered around her.
"Sister Ying, the art department really helped a lot with the promotional posters for 'Floating Dreams' last year!"
"We're all from the same company, no need to be so polite."
"Sister Ying, those limited edition keycaps with the Holy Grail War theme sold really well. When will our art department make a set of the Final Front version?"
"You need to go through the proper procedures and find He Xiaofei for this."
Actually, many things don't need to be discussed now, but Song Yueying is indeed very popular in the company. For Xingchen's higher-ups, Song Yueying is their "middleman" between Chu Chen and them.
For most ordinary employees, Song Yueying is beautiful and easy-going. Even if they don't usually interact, it's normal for her to come up and chat for a bit.
Song Yueying's popularity caused Cheng Chenyu to move slightly to the side.
The main issue was that what he wanted to say wasn't suitable to be discussed in front of too many people. As he leaned back, he noticed that someone next to him also leaned back a little.
Their eyes met.
"Hello, I'm Takumi Nagano."
The man, named Nagano Taku, was around forty years old. He was dressed in a well-fitting casual suit, which stood out from the beach shorts and oversized T-shirts around him.
However, this person's eyes were somewhat similar to Cheng Chenyu's, and he was clearly a little nervous as well.
Indeed, this is true. Like Cheng Chenyu, Nagano Takuyu is also a member of the "ambition party".
However, his direction of advancement is somewhat different from Cheng Chenyu's. His goal is another, larger and more complex area within the company's empire: the operational system.
Despite its rapid development over the past two years and its dazzling success in the gaming industry, Xingchen's platform operation and distribution system seems rather unremarkable.
But in reality, the Starry Sky platform's operation and distribution system is the sector that Chu Chen values most in the entire company.
This section has a total of "three driving forces" and "three wheels".
The "three pillars" refer to Star Tap, Star Wallpaper, and Star Game Platform, which have a massive user base.
The three wheels refer to the three auxiliary departments of Star Animation, Star Variety Shows, and Star Events Operation, which are responsible for attracting traffic, creating content, and generating buzz for the core product.
In the past, each of these sectors had its own studio, and under Chu Chen's personal coordination, they cooperated with each other to promote the Star Channel.
However, as the company grew exponentially, its business spread across the globe.
Chu Chen clearly felt that he was overwhelmed.
The biggest reason for this is that as the Starry Sky channel continues to strengthen, studios that rely on Starry Sky-themed merchandise are also expanding rapidly.
For example, Star Animation had by then split into Star Japan, Star China, and the newly established Star China 3D Animation Studio.
The same applies to the variety show sector. After Ma Yuanyao took over Xinghai Liuying Studio, which is the variety show production department of Xingchen Huaxia, Xingchen's program sector has also been developing rapidly.
With ample financial support from their parent companies, the variety show divisions of Starry Japan and Starry China are fiercely competitive.
Earlier this year, Hoshino Japan even proposed a regular game show featuring their three brand ambassadors: Yui Aragaki, Satomi Ishihara, and Nogizaka46. They didn't discuss the feasibility of the proposal, nor did they mention the budget or how to coordinate schedules.
The fact that this plan was even proposed, a feasibility report was written, and it was ultimately submitted to Chu Chen shows just how hard Xingchen Japan's variety show department was trying to avoid being outdone by Ma Yuanyao.
With so many studios, there are many ideas, and everyone has new ideas. Asking Chu Chen to take care of everything and evaluate the feasibility of each project is clearly beyond his management limits.
In addition to coordinating the work within the operations team, coordination is also needed between the operations department, the game development department, and other related departments.
In the past, Chu Chen was the absolute core, the brain, the central nervous system of the stars.
All the information is gathered in his hands, and then he makes the decisions and distributes them to various departments for execution.
This model was extremely efficient in the early stages of the company, ensuring absolute execution.
Chu Chen also used the studio reporting system, and through high-intensity work and Song Yueying's sharing of the workload, he managed to maintain the system.
However, as the stars continue to expand, if all the information continues to flood Chu Chen as before, even if he had forty-eight hours a day, it wouldn't be enough.
Even more fatally, as the stars grew larger, information barriers and internal resource consumption began to emerge between various departments.
For example, if the Japanese animation department wants to create a promotional PV for a game character, the game studio in China may already have a ready-made 3D model. However, due to poor communication, the Japanese side is unaware of this and has to recreate the model, wasting time and money.
For example, if Ma Yuanyao wanted to invite a Japanese game producer to a program, she had to go through Chu Chen to coordinate the schedule. By the time they did, it was too late.
Thus, the Star Channel Executive Committee was established.
This organization does not directly generate content, but it controls the allocation of resources and strategic coordination among all non-game content departments.
It's like a super secretariat, or rather, the cabinet of ancient emperors.
Chu Chen still holds the decision-making power, but the daily "memorials" will first be screened, sorted, and given preliminary "draft" opinions by this committee.
The committee will appoint regional heads for China, Japan, and Europe and the United States to oversee all channel businesses, including animation, variety shows, and platform operations, within their respective regions.
Although the identity of the person in charge of this "cabinet" has not been officially announced, it has been basically confirmed that it is Song Yueying, who is currently surrounded by people and smiling sweetly.
This appointment came as almost no surprise to those in well-informed executive circles.
In terms of official position, Song Yueying is a veteran of the company, having risen from art director to project director, and now effectively become the "chief steward."
Personally, Song Yueying is the only person in the entire company who can find Chu Chen anytime, anywhere, and influence his decisions in the most direct and effective way.
With her in charge, this newly established committee can truly function, instead of becoming just a figurehead.
Of course, with the establishment of the "cabinet", Song Yueying also needed people under her, and what Nagano Takuyu wanted was the position of person in charge of the Japanese region.
He was originally a senior employee at Sony Music Entertainment. When Tap was expanding into Japan, he was recruited by Li Suhao to work at Tap, where he was responsible for localized marketing and content operations.
However, Nagano Takuyu faces the same problem as Cheng Chenyu.
That means you want to get the position, and so do others. In theory, there are many candidates who can get the position, so he not only has to show his abilities in front of Song Yueying, but also make an impression on the boss.
